Typical Signs of Moisture in a Building
Moisture issues within a building can manifest with several noticeable indications that suggest the visibility of moisture. One popular sign is the appearance of water spots on wall surfaces or ceilings, which typically suggests wetness seepage. Additionally, peeling off or gurgling paint can recommend that excess humidity is entraped underneath the surface area, leading to deterioration. An additional usual sign is the existence of mold and mildew, which prosper in moist problems and can usually be identified by their stuffy odor. A surge in moisture levels can cause condensation on home windows and other surfaces, highlighting dampness problems. Ultimately, distorted or irregular floor covering might indicate underlying moisture that compromises architectural integrity. Recognizing these indicators early can help reduce prospective damages and maintain a secure living setting. Normal examinations and timely activity are crucial in resolving dampness issues prior to they intensify.

Various Kinds Of Damp Proofing Solutions
Although various aspects can add to damp issues in structures, choosing the ideal wet proofing remedy is essential for protecting structural integrity. A number of options are readily available, each customized to details conditions.One typical solution is a damp-proof membrane layer (DPM), typically made of polyethylene or asphalt, which is installed in floorings and wall surfaces to protect against wetness ingress. Another alternative is damp-proof courses (DPC), which are layers of water resistant product put within wall surfaces to block climbing damp.Chemical damp proofing involves injecting waterproofing chemicals right into wall surfaces to produce an obstacle against wetness. In addition, exterior treatments such as tanking, which entails using a waterproof layer to the exterior of foundations, can be effective in protecting against water penetration.Each option has its benefits and is picked based upon the structure's specific problems, environmental problems, and long-term upkeep factors to consider, making sure excellent defense versus damp-related damage.

Choosing the Right Damp Proofing Method for Your Home
Which moist proofing technique is most suitable for a specific property typically depends upon various factors, consisting of the building's age, existing dampness issues, and neighborhood ecological conditions. For older frameworks, traditional techniques such as bitumen membrane layers or cementitious coatings might be extra efficient, as they can offer a durable barrier against increasing damp. In comparison, newer structures might gain from contemporary options like infused damp-proof programs, which are less intrusive and can be tailored to specific dampness challenges.Additionally, residential or commercial properties in locations with high water tables or hefty rainfall may call for advanced methods, such as cavity wall drainage systems or exterior waterproofing. Property owners need to additionally consider the certain materials used in their building's building and construction, as some methods might not work. Eventually, a comprehensive evaluation by a professional can assist homeowner in picking one of the most efficient damp proofing technique tailored to their unique situations.
